Camaralzaman ( _fa. Moon of the century) was the son of King Schahzaman of Persia in the Arabian Nights story called "The Adventures of Prince Camarlzaman and the Princess Badoura". He married the lovely young Chinese princess Badoura and took a concubine named Princess Haiatelnefous, the daughter of King Armanos of the Ebony Island.
